Common Mold Remediation Scams in Natural Bridge
Be aware of these tactic used by unlicensed operators
The Phantom Mold Scare
An inspector or contractor claims you have a severe "toxic black mold" problem and shows you alarming photos — sometimes taken from a different property. They recommend thousands of dollars in urgent remediation that you don't actually need.
Upfront Payment Disappearance
The contractor demands a large deposit — often 50-100% up front — to order materials and secure your spot on their schedule. After you pay, they delay repeatedly and eventually stop answering calls.
The Scope Creep Bait-and-Switch
The company gives you a low-ball estimate to win the job, then once work begins, they "discover" hidden mold everywhere and demand significantly more money — often leaving you with a half-finished job if you refuse.
Unsupervised Crew with No Insurance
A company sends an unlicensed crew with no safety equipment, no containment setup, and no liability insurance. If they damage your home or someone gets hurt on your property, you're left holding the bag.
How to Verify a Professional
Insurance
Ask for a certificate of insurance directly from their provider, not just a printed card. Verify they carry both general liability insurance (to cover damage to your property) and workers' compensation insurance (to protect you if a worker is injured on your property). Call the insurance agency listed to confirm the policy is active.
Licensing
Alabama does not have a statewide license specifically for mold remediation, but reputable companies often hold applicable trade licenses through the Alabama Home Builders Licensure Board. Ask for their license number and verify it at www.hblb.alabama.gov. Also check if they carry certifications from the IICRC (Institute of Inspection, Cleaning and Restoration Certification).
References
Ask for at least three recent local references — homeowners they've worked for in Natural Bridge or nearby Winston County towns. Contact each reference and ask: Was the work completed on time? Was the final price close to the estimate? Did the mold come back afterward? A trustworthy pro should have a list ready without hesitation.
